  • The yin-yang philosophy says that the universe is composed of competing and complementary forces of dark and light, sun and moon, male and female.
  • The philosophy is at least 3,500 years old, discussed in the ninth-century BCE text known as I Ching or Book of Changes
  • The symbol is related to the ancient method used to track the movements of the sun, moon, and stars around the year.

Yin and yang elements come in pairs—such as female and male, moon and sun, dark and bright, cold and hot, passive and active, and so on—note that they are not static or mutually exclusive terms. While the world is composed of many different, sometimes opposing forces, these can coexist and even complement each other. Sometimes, forces opposite in nature even rely on one another to exist.

The nature of this duality lies in the interchange and interplay of the two components. The alternation of day and night is just such an example: there cannot be a shadow without light. 

Their balance is important. If one is stronger, the other will be weaker and they can interchange under certain conditions. In other words, yin elements can contain certain parts of yang, and yang can have some components of yin. The balance of this duality is perceived to exist in everything.
